Factors Influencing Electricity Production from Dams

Various factors determine how much electricity a dam can produce, notably:

  • Height of the Waterfall: The distance the water falls directly affects its power generation capability. For example, a 100-foot dam can produce twice as much energy as a 50-foot dam.

  • Volume of Water: The more water flowing through the dam, the greater the potential for electricity production. While the flow of water is not entirely controllable, operators can manage the flow rate to adjust electricity output.
